All our patterns are the highest quality that can be created for the given size and color constraints. Occasionally this results in some threads that are only used for a handful of stitches in a pattern but we include them because they are the best matches for those colors. You can stitch them as-is or you can use your own judgement and may decide to replace them with another similar color that is already used elsewhere in the pattern. Image Sizes

Patterns can be used with any canvas type, all that will change is the physical dimensions of the completed image. To allow for mounting a cross-stitch piece in a frame we recommend a canvas size with at least 3 additional inches on each edge.

Completed Image Size Suggested Canvas Size
Canvas Type Width Height Width Height
11 Count Aida 32 ¾" 27 ¼" 38 ¾" 33 ¼"
14 Count Aida 25 ¾" 21 ½" 31 ¾" 27 ½"
16 Count Aida 22 ½" 18 ¾" 28 ½" 24 ¾"
18 Count Aida 20" 16 ¾" 26" 22 ¾"
20 Count Aida 18" 15" 24" 21"
22 Count Hardanger 16 ¼" 13 ¾" 22 ¼" 19 ¾"
25 Count Evenweave 14 ½" 12" 20 ½" 18"
28 Count Evenweave 12 ¾" 10 ¾" 18 ¾" 16 ¾"
32 Count Evenweave 11 ¼" 9 ½" 17 ¼" 15 ½"
